  • Patent number: 6355541
    Abstract: Systems and methods are described for transfer of a thin-film via implantation, wafer bonding, and separation. A method for transfer of a thin-film, includes: implanting a source crystal with ions along a crystallographic channel and at a temperature of at least approximately 200° C. to i) form a strained region and ii) define the thin-film; then bonding a surface of the thin-film to a target wafer; and then separating a) the target wafer and the thin-film from b) a remainder of the source crystal along the strained region. The systems and methods provide advantages because the electrical carriers in the crystal, and consequently the thin-film, are not deactivated and the quality of the transferred thin-film is improved.

  • Patent number: 5753560
    Abstract: A semiconductor structure (20) includes a silicon layer (16) formed on an oxide layer (14). Gettering sinks (31, 32) are formed in the silicon layer (16). Lateral gettering is performed to effectively remove impurities from a first section (26) of the semiconductor layer (16). An insulated gate semiconductor device (40) is then formed in semiconductor layer (16), wherein a channel region (55) of the device (40) is formed in the first section (26) of the semiconductor layer (16). A gate dielectric layer (42) of the device (40) is formed over a portion of the first section (26) after the lateral gettering process, thereby enhancing the integrity of the gate dielectric layer (42).
